Volunteer: Walk MS: Ocean City, MD 2026 - Circles of Support VolunteersCircles of Support In Tent Volunteers: Setting up/taking down tent, set up and manage circle fans and offer instruction to participants on what they represent and how to use during the Program. Take inventory post event of circle fans. Circles of Support (roamers): Roam the site with baskets of Circle of Support circle fans, passing out to all participants and explaining what they are and how to use during the Program. Best recruits for this role are outgoing and love talking with participants. Complete the Circle Display Greeters Setting up/taking down Complete the Circle interactive graphic, set up and manage circle stickers and offer instruction to participants on how to fill out and apply circle stickers to graphic. Take inventory post event of Circle of Support Stickers Timing for this role may change as we get closer to the event date. The time set currently is the earliest it would be. Top Fundraiser Area (TFA)
Assisting Top Fundraiser (TF) participants n the Top Fundraiser Area (TFA) and more. Tasks may include setting up/breaking down area, decorating, providing great customer service, registration, food & beverage, and passing out credentials.
TFA Check-in
Provides high-level of customer service and registration services for Top Fundraisers, Includes setting up/breaking down TFA Check-in, providing check in and registration services, answer questions.
TFA Photo Area
Stationed at the step-and-repeat display to assist TF participants take photos. Can use their personal photography equipment, cell phone or participants cell phone. If more than one in TFA area, can take candid photos around the area.
TFA Food and Beverage Team
Setting up/taking down the food and beverage area. Provide an elevated food and beverage experience to TFs, set out water and other beverages, serve coffee ( if not self-serve) lay out snacks. Keep area clean.
